转: C/C++,字符串的UTF-8与GBK(或GB2312)编码转换
写代码时经常会遇到各种编码转换问题,因此记录下来以便日后对各种平台下不同编码转换作整理。
C/C++:
GBK(或GB2312)转UTF-8实现:
UTF-8转GBK(或GB2312)实现:
本文提供了C/C++环境下GBK(或GB2312)与UTF-8编码互相转换的方法。通过两个示例函数展示了如何使用Windows API函数MultiByteToWideChar和WideCharToMultiByte来实现字符串编码的转换。
转: C/C++,字符串的UTF-8与GBK(或GB2312)编码转换
写代码时经常会遇到各种编码转换问题,因此记录下来以便日后对各种平台下不同编码转换作整理。
C/C++:
GBK(或GB2312)转UTF-8实现:

被折叠的 条评论
为什么被折叠?